We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
2 parents 1deeb8a + ca37484 commit f9c4ee9Copy full SHA for f9c4ee9
1 file changed
src/main/java/com/onelogin/saml/Response.java
@@ -193,7 +193,7 @@ public boolean isValid(String... requestId){
193
194
NodeList subjectConfirmationDataNodes = scn.getChildNodes();
195
for(int c = 0; c < subjectConfirmationDataNodes.getLength(); c++){
196
- if(subjectConfirmationDataNodes.item(c).getLocalName().equals("SubjectConfirmationData")){
+ if(subjectConfirmationDataNodes.item(c).getLocalName() != null && subjectConfirmationDataNodes.item(c).getLocalName().equals("SubjectConfirmationData")){
197
198
Node recipient = subjectConfirmationDataNodes.item(c).getAttributes().getNamedItem("Recipient");
199
if(recipient != null && !recipient.getNodeValue().isEmpty() && !recipient.getNodeValue().equals(currentUrl)){
0 commit comments